Hardware Quality Technician

3 weeks ago


Kitchener, Canada Miovision Full time

Position Summary

Working in the Hardware Quality team, this position will act as a key technical resource responsible for analyzing field returns to attempt to replicate customer symptoms, identify failure root causes and drive continuous quality improvement improvement. Position requires a hands-on focus so the role will be in-office at Miovision headquarters (Kitchener, Ontario).

Position will require collaborative work with electrical engineering, mechanical engineering, firmware development, customer support and manufacturing/supply chain teams. Strong attention to detail is required due to the volume of data that will be involved with device analysis.

Key Accountabilities

Hands on root cause analysis of devices (field returns and NCRs) to diagnose and resolve both hardware and firmware related issues Document findings in QMS to detail device history, root cause analysis steps and root cause findings Drive continuous improvement activities to strengthen Miovision Quality Management System (QMS) Develop and refine debug processes to assist both HW QA and related teams with root cause analysis efficiency Work closely with engineering (electrical engineering, mechanical engineering, firmware development), manufacturing and supply chain teams to coordinate work Relay findings from RCA to engineering design and customer support teams to drive continuous improvement Manage non-conforming material and containment Monitor quality KPIs and identify areas of focus. Assess trends based on root cause analysis data Work with suppliers to ensure quality product is being provided to Miovision Ownership and accountability for the sustainability and triage processes for in-life hardware products

Skills/Qualifications

Must haves

3+ years experience in a hands-on engineering or quality related role Experience with 8D methodology for problem solving Past experience in a hardware root cause analysis focused role Past experience with debug processes including hands-on measurement work Past experience with electronic design & debug Electrical, mechanical, or any related technical degree/diploma Proven track record of effective communication with interdepartmental teams Strong knowledge of electrical or mechanical systems, or both Strong analytical and problem solving skills Very detailed oriented personality Interest in learning and applying skills to a wide range of technical applications
